Hand-over of clean water and sanitation system for medical clinic and kindergarten in Hoa An commune
After more than 3 months under construction (starting in early 2017) with a total budget of over 500 million VND (approximately 22,000 USD), a water system and latrine for the medical clinic and a latrine for the kindergarten in Hoa An commune have been completed and put into use.
Hoa An Kindergarten was invested to build a new 4-rooms latrine of over 20m2 in size, with an adequate lighting and clean water system which can meet the needs of 210 school children. In addition, the school was also supported by LDSC with a number of teaching and day-care facilities and equipment. The medical clinic was invested in a new 4-rooms latrine and a clean water system to replace the old and polluted ones. It’s believed that these works and support by the LDSC will help improve the school children’s health and the quality of teaching and learning at the kindergarten as well as the quality of local people's health care at the medical clinic.
